The Texas Legislature is considering a ban on nearly all forms of THC, the psychoactive agent in marijuana.
State Senator Charles Perry of Lubbock wrote Senate Bill 3 to tighten regulations on THC products sold in convenience stores and vape shops. State law allows hemp products with trace amounts of non-intoxicating Delta 9 THC.
Supporters of Senate Bill 3 claim the current law creates a loophole that enables retailers to sell dangerous THC products to adults and children. Lieutenant Governor Dan Patrick supports the new bill.
